Sauce, sweet and sour, ready-to-serve: nutrition facts
A 100 g serving of Sauce, sweet and sour, ready-to-serve has 154 calories. About 99% of those calories come from carbohydrates, 1% from protein and 0% from fat.
- 154calories per 100 g
- 0.27 gprotein
- 38.22 gcarbohydrates
- 0.02 gfat
Nutrition facts per 100 g
| Nutrient | Amount |
|---|---|
| Calories | 154 kcal |
| Protein | 0.27 g |
| Total fat | 0.02 g |
| Saturated fat | 0 g |
| Carbohydrates | 38.22 g |
| Fiber | 0.1 g |
| Sugars | 18.75 g |
| Sodium | 539 mg |
| Potassium | 99 mg |
| Cholesterol | 0 mg |
| Calcium | 10 mg |
| Iron | 0.21 mg |
Nutrition per serving
| Serving | Weight | Calories | Protein | Carbs | Fat |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Tbsp | 35 g | 54 | 0.1 g | 13.4 g | 0 g |
Values are averages from USDA FoodData Central and vary by brand, ripeness and preparation. This is general information, not medical or dietary advice.
